NCGrowth Hosts National Webinar on Purposeful Purchasing with IEDC and NGIN
Jan 5, 2026 • News & Media • 2 min read
Alyse Polly, formerly of NCGrowth and now at UC Berkeley, moderated a conversation with Deborah Diamond of the Federal Reserve Bank of Philadelphia, Swati Ghosh of the New Growth Innovation Network, and Dell Gines of the International Economic Development Council on how anchor institutions can turn everyday spending into engines of inclusive growth. Diamond outlined how universities and hospitals shape local prosperity through employment, procurement, and construction, and described tools that quantify both direct impacts and ripple effects across jobs, income, and GDP. Ghosh emphasized inclusive procurement as a practical pathway for small and diverse businesses to build wealth—especially in smaller cities where a handful of large buyers dominate demand—while Gines framed anchors as catalysts in a broader, modern approach to economic development that centers communities, small firms, and shared prosperity.
